I found the Rice Krispies Dipper Treats recipe in a magazine and knew my kids would love them. We dipped ours into dark chocolate and really bright sprinkles, and put them right in the fridge. When they were ready, we all sat on the porch swing together and tried them. The kids loved that they were cold - it gave them an added crunch. They were such a huge hit, we promised to make them again before summer comes to an end.
